    In the virgin jungle of Kalimantan Island, Bill Johnson led his expedition team through it, looking for a rare plant called "Blood Orchid". In the records, the blood orchid has the mysterious power that can make people immortal, and the rumor that "almost no one has obtained it" has gradually made the blood orchid a legend. This time, entrusted by a famous pharmaceutical company, Bill and his party decided to uncover the mystery of blood orchid. As you get closer and closer to your goal, danger also looms. The power of the blood orchid did not rejuvenate human beings, but turned a group of snakes into ferocious and terrifying. In order to move their huge bodies, they had to eat several times more food than before, and the humans who took the liberty to visit at this time became their best prey. One side is the harsh ecological environment in the jungle, and the other side is the vicious cannibalistic beast. His companions died tragically one by one. Bill was finally able to protect himself and save more lives   .
    The film was released in the United States on August 27, 2004 .   

    Details

    • Release date August 27, 2004
    • Filming locations New Zealand
    • Production companies Screen Gems, Middle Fork Productions

    Box office

    Budget

    $20,000,000 (estimated)

    Gross US & Canada

    $32,238,923

    Opening weekend US & Canada

    $12,812,287

    Gross worldwide

    $70,992,898
